Hallo,

Using libpqexec many error details can retrieved:
http://www.postgresql.org/docs/8.4/interactive/libpq-exec.html
(such as PG_DIAG_SEVERITY, PG_DIAG_MESSAGE_HINT,
PG_DIAG_STATEMENT_POSITION.. as on the site above)
eg:
http://pgsql.privatepaste.com/656698b511

but when u try to trap/catch all these errors,
this doesnt seem possible from withing plpgsql,
where we only have SQLSTATE and SQLERRM
eg.
http://www.postgresql.org/docs/current/interactive/plpgsql-control-structures.html
http://pgsql.privatepaste.com/3b71488e8a

So i think it would be interesting to be able to access the other error
details as given by libpg-exec as well.
Eg adding SEVERITY, MESSAGE_HINT, STATEMENT_POSITION, ..
where we now only have SQLSTATE and SQLERRM

Patch for access to hint, detail, context is in process this commitfest.
